Работа 2 Создание Базы Данных Состоящей из Двух Таблиц • Один к одному

Базы данных Access: функции, режимы работы и элементы

Не забудьте, что сводную таблицу нужно периодически при изменении исходных данных обновлять, щелкнув по ней правой кнопкой мыши и выбрав команду Обновить Refresh , т.

Связи между таблицами базы данных

Связи — это довольна важная тема, которую следует понимать при проектировании баз данных. По своему личному опыту скажу, что осознав связи, мне намного легче далось понимание нормализации базы данных.

Связи создаются с помощью внешних ключей (foreign key).
Внешний ключ — это атрибут или набор атрибутов, которые ссылаются на primary key или unique другой таблицы. Другими словами, это что-то вроде указателя на строку другой таблицы.

Руководство по проектированию реляционных баз данных (1-3 часть из 15) перевод / Хабр

Следуя правилам реляционной модели данных вы можете быть уверены, что ваши данные могут быть перенесены в другую РСУБД относительно просто.

Руководство по проектированию реляционных баз данных (1-3 часть из 15) [перевод]

Перевод цикла из 15 статей о проектировании баз данных.
Информация предназначена для новичков.
Помогло мне. Возможно, что поможет еще кому-то восполнить пробелы.

1. Вступление.
Структурированный язык запросов (SQL).

SQL – большая тема для повествования и его рассмотрение выходит за рамки данного руководства. Данная статья строго сфокусирована на изложении процесса проектирования баз данных. Позднее, в отдельном руководстве, я расскажу об основах SQL.

Реляционная модель.

В этом руководстве я покажу вам как создавать реляционную модель данных. Реляционная модель – это модель, которая описывает как организовать данные в таблицах и как определить связи между этими таблицами.

Примеры.

Существует отличное бесплатное приложение MySQL Workbench. Оно позволяет спроектировать вашу базу данных графически. Изображения диаграмм в руководстве сделаны в этой программе.

Проектирование независимо от РСУБД.

В следующей части я коротко расскажу об эволюции баз данных. Вы узнаете откуда взялись базы данных и реляционная модель данных.

2. История.
Таблицы баз данных.

Современные реляционные базы данных созданы так, чтобы позволять делать выборку данных из специфических строк, столбцов и множественных таблиц, за раз, очень быстро.

История реляционной модели.
3. Характеристики реляционных баз данных.

Реляционные базы данных разработаны для быстрого сохранения и получения больших объемов информации. Ниже приведены некоторые характеристики реляционных баз данных и реляционной модели данных.

Использование ключей.
Отсутствие избыточности данных.
Ограничение ввода.

Используя реляционную базу данных вы можете определить какой вид данных позволено сохранять в столбце. Вы можете создать поле, которое содержит целые числа, десятичные числа, небольшие фрагменты текста, большие фрагменты текста, даты и т.д.

Поддержание целостности данных.
Назначение прав.
Структурированный язык запросов (SQL).
Переносимость.

Реляционная модель данных стандартна. Следуя правилам реляционной модели данных вы можете быть уверены, что ваши данные могут быть перенесены в другую РСУБД относительно просто.

Мнение эксперта
Знайка, главный эксперт в Цветочном городе
Если у вас возникли сложности, обращайтесь ко мне, и я помогу разобраться 🦉  
Задать вопрос эксперту
Путеводитель по базам данных в 2024 г / Хабр Теперь необходимо указать, что поле Num будет являться первичным ключом. А если у Вас остались вопросы, задайте их мне!

Лабораторная работа №1

В обозревателе объектов должна появиться новая база если сразу не появилась, то надо выделить мышью раздел Базы данных и в контекстном меню выбрать Обновить.

Создание таблиц базы данных с помощью SQL-запроса

и нажмем F5. В обозревателе объектов должна появиться новая база (если сразу не появилась, то надо выделить мышью раздел «Базы данных» и в контекстном меню выбрать «Обновить»).

Эта таблица содержит поле Speciality, которое ссылается на первичный ключ таблицы Speciality. Чтобы создать такую таблицу, необходимо выполнить запрос:

Примечание. Ссылку можно создать только на существующую таблицу. Задать ссылку по внешнему ключу можно и после создания таблицы (подробно будет рассмотрено в следующей лабораторной работе).

Мнение эксперта
Знайка, главный эксперт в Цветочном городе
Если у вас возникли сложности, обращайтесь ко мне, и я помогу разобраться 🦉  
Задать вопрос эксперту
Связи между таблицами базы данных / Хабр В следующей части я коротко расскажу об эволюции баз данных. А если у Вас остались вопросы, задайте их мне!

2. Виды связей

При этом у каждого пользователя может быть от одного и больше номеров телефонов многие номера телефонов.

Шаг 4. Связываем таблицы

Для этого на вкладке Данные (Data) нажмите кнопку Отношения (Relations) . В появившемся окне нажмите кнопку Создать (New) и выберите из выпадающих списков таблицы и названия столбцов, по которым они должны быть связаны:

Мнение эксперта
Знайка, главный эксперт в Цветочном городе
Если у вас возникли сложности, обращайтесь ко мне, и я помогу разобраться 🦉  
Задать вопрос эксперту
2. Почему мы не делаем тут таблицу-посредника? Оно отличается от ограничения unique лишь тем, что не может принимать значения null. А если у Вас остались вопросы, задайте их мне!

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Этот сайт использует Akismet для борьбы со спамом. Узнайте, как обрабатываются ваши данные комментариев.